Which should you choose?
Choose InkToAudio if…
- You publish on a schedule and want every issue turned into audio automatically.
- You want a hosted player and a podcast feed without managing files yourself.
- You want listener analytics to see what your audience actually finishes.
- Your audio lives on your site and in podcast apps, not inside videos.
Murf may fit if…
- You produce one-off voiceovers for videos, ads, e-learning, or presentations.
- You need AI dubbing or video narration across many languages.
- You want a studio editor to fine-tune individual clips and export files.
Many publishers use a studio like Murf for occasional video voiceovers and InkToAudio for their recurring written content. The two are not mutually exclusive.
